Ito ang command pod2pdfp na maaaring patakbuhin sa OnWorks na libreng hosting provider gamit ang isa sa aming maramihang libreng online na workstation gaya ng Ubuntu Online, Fedora Online, Windows online emulator o MAC OS online emulator
PROGRAMA:
NAME
pod2pdf - kino-convert ang Pod sa format na PDF
DESCRIPTION
Ang pod2pdf ay nagko-convert ng mga dokumentong nakasulat sa Perl's POD (Plain Old Documentation) na format sa PDF
file.
Paggamit
pod2pdf [mga opsyon] input.pod >output.pdf
Kung walang tinukoy na input filename, mababasa ang pod2pdf mula sa STDIN, hal
perldoc -u File::Hanapin | pod2pdf [mga opsyon] >File-Find.pdf
Options
Tinatanggap ng pod2pdf ang sumusunod na mga opsyon sa command-line:
"--output-file"
Itinatakda ang output filename para sa nabuong PDF file. Bilang default, maglalabas ang pod2pdf sa
STDOUT.
"--laki ng pahina"
Itinatakda ang laki ng pahina na gagamitin sa PDF file, maaaring itakda sa alinman sa karaniwang papel
laki (A4, A5, Letter, atbp). Mga Default sa A4.
"--page-orientation"
Kinokontrol kung ang mga pahina ay ginagawa sa landscape o portrait na format. Default sa
'larawan'.
"--page-width", "--page-height"
Itinatakda ang lapad at taas ng nabuong mga pahina sa mga puntos (para sa paggamit ng hindi pamantayan
mga sukat ng papel).
"--left-margin", "--right-margin", "--top-margin", "--bottom-margin"
Nagbibigay-daan sa bawat isa sa mga margin ng pahina (itaas, ibaba, kaliwa, at kanan) na isa-isang itakda
sa mga punto.
"--margin"
Itinatakda ang lahat ng mga margin ng pahina sa parehong laki (tinukoy sa mga puntos).
"--header", "--noheader"
Kinokontrol kung gagawin ng isang header (na naglalaman ng pamagat ng pahina, at opsyonal na timestamp at icon).
isama sa bawat pahina. Ang mga default ay naka-on, kaya gamitin ang "--noheader" upang i-disable.
"--pamagat"
Itinatakda ang pamagat ng pahina (mga default sa input filename).
"--timestamp"
Boolean na opsyon - kung nakatakda, kasama ang 'huling binagong' timestamp ng input file sa
ang header ng pahina.
"--icon"
Filename ng isang icon na ipapakita sa kaliwang sulok sa itaas ng bawat page.
"--icon-scale"
Pag-scale ng halaga para sa icon ng header (naka-default sa 0.25).
"--footer", "--nofooter"
Kinokontrol kung gagawin ng footer (na naglalaman ng kasalukuyang numero ng pahina at opsyonal na text string).
isama sa bawat pahina. Bilang default, isasama ang footer, kaya gamitin ang "--nofooter"
huwag paganahin.
"--footer-text"
Nagtatakda ng opsyonal na footer text string na isasama sa kaliwang sulok sa ibaba ng
bawat pahina.
"--mga balangkas"
Nagdaragdag ng mga balangkas (mga bookmark) sa pdf ayon sa mga heading (=head1, =head2, ...).
"--bersyon"
Nagpi-print ng numero ng bersyon at paglabas.
Configuration file
Maaaring i-save ang mga hanay ng mga opsyon sa command-line sa mga configuration file.
Ang isang configuration file ay naglalaman ng mga opsyon sa parehong format na ginamit ng pod2pdf sa
command-line, na may isang opsyon na ibinigay sa bawat linya ng file, hal
--laki ng pahina A5
--page-orientation landscape
Para gumamit ng config file, i-invoke ang pod2pdf na may opsyong "@/path/to/configfile.conf".
Halimbawa, kung gusto mong palaging magsama ng logo ng kumpanya, timestamp, at copyright
paunawa sa iyong mga PDF file, lumikha ng isang file mycompany.conf naglalaman ng mga sumusunod:
--icon "/path/to/your/logo.png"
--footer-text "Copyright 2007 MyCompany Limited"
--timestamp
Pagkatapos ay i-invoke ang pod2pdf bilang:
pod2pdf @/path/to/mycompany.conf input.pod >output.pdf
Kung lumikha ka ng isang config file na tinatawag na pod2pdf.conf at ilagay ito sa parehong direktoryo bilang
ang pod2pdf script, ilo-load ito bilang default na configuration.
Supot ng buto MGA ENTENSYON
Pati na rin ang mga karaniwang POD command (tingnan ang perlpodspec), sinusuportahan ng pod2pdf ang mga sumusunod
mga extension sa POD format:
"=ff"
Ang command na "=ff" ay naglalagay ng page bread (form feed) sa dokumento.
"O<...>"
Ang "O<...>" formatting code ay naglalagay ng panlabas na bagay (file) sa dokumento. Ito
Pangunahing nilayon para sa pag-embed ng mga larawan, hal
O
upang magpasok ng mga diagram, atbp sa dokumentasyon.
Sinusuportahan ng pod2pdf ang mga uri ng file na JPG, GIF, TIFF, PNG, at PNM para sa mga naka-embed na bagay.
MGA DEPENDENSIYA
Nangangailangan ang pod2pdf ng mga sumusunod na module na mai-install:
PDF::API2
Pod::Escapes
Getopt::ArgvFile
Bilang karagdagan upang magamit ang mga imahe, ang mga module na File::Type at Image::Size ay dapat na naka-install, at
upang tukuyin ang mga alternatibong laki ng pahina ang Paper::Specs module ay kinakailangan.
Gumamit ng pod2pdfp online gamit ang mga serbisyo ng onworks.net